2025-01-09
Game File 7 related

December court filing: Activision revealed that Call of Duty: Black Ops III cost $450M+ to make, Modern Warfare cost $640M+, and Black Ops Cold War cost $700M+

The biggest development budgets ever disclosed by a game company, buried in a court filing (but found by Game File), along with updated sales figures.

2024-04-17
Bloomberg 5 related

Activision drops team entry fees for its professional Call of Duty League, and will return prior collected fees, as the esports industry faces profit challenges

The teams, including ones owned by sports-business billionaires Robert Kraft and Stan Kroenke, will no longer be required to pay …

2022-04-26
GamesIndustry.biz 3 related

Activision Blizzard reports Q1 revenue down 22% YoY to $1.77B, net income down 36% to $395M, Activision MAUs down 33% to 100M, and Blizzard MAUs down 19% to 22M

2022-01-19
Bloomberg 85 related

Sony's shares fell 13% on Wednesday, its biggest drop since October 2008, wiping $20B off its valuation, after Microsoft announced its Activision deal

Sony Group Corp. shares fell 13% in Tokyo on Wednesday, their biggest drop since October 2008, after PlayStation rival Microsoft Corp. announced …

2021-08-04
VentureBeat 9 related

Activision beats expectations in Q2 with revenue of $2.29B, up 19% YoY, and net bookings of $1.92B, down only 7% YoY, notes risks of the sexual harassment suit

Activision Blizzard reported earnings today that beat Wall Street's and its own expectations with 19% revenue growth to $2.29 billion for the second quarter ended June 30.
